Joint Farm Co., Ltd. is based in Aomori, one of Japan’s leading agricultural regions, producing and distributing vegetables such as Nagaimo (Japanese yam), Burdock, and Garlic.
Vegetables grown in Aomori’s harsh natural environment possess robust vitality and rich flavor, earning high recognition both domestically and internationally.

We manage the entire process—from production to sorting, packing, and shipping—ensuring quality that meets international standards. With comprehensive G-GAP certification and pesticide residue testing, we have established a high level of safety and reliability, allowing us to confidently supply markets around the world.

Currently, through partnerships with major domestic trading companies and wholesalers, we export to the United States, Taiwan, Southeast Asia, and many other countries. Working through trading companies allows smoother settlement and customs clearance, reducing risks and enabling stable transactions for buyers. Product

Aomori’s Proud
Sticky Nagaimo (Japanese yam)

Nagaimo (Japanese yam) grown in the snowy lands of Aomori is highly valued both domestically and internationally for its strong stickiness and unique flavor. With rising health awareness, demand is expanding, particularly in Asian markets, and we are ready to meet it with a stable supply system. We accommodate export standards in length, weight, and shape, with flexible shipment from boxed to pallet packaging.
  • Features

    Strong stickiness and mild taste make it suitable for Japanese, Western, and Chinese cuisine. Its high nutritional value also makes it popular in health-conscious markets.
  • Standards & Sizes

    Export standards for length, weight, and shape are available. Shipments can be flexibly packed in boxes or pallets.
  • Harvest & Supply Schedule

    Nagaimo (Japanese yam) is harvested from October to December and stored in dedicated facilities for year-round stable supply. Annual shipments reach approximately 1,500 tons (700 tons from Hokkaido, 800 tons from Aomori).

Q1. How are transactions conducted?

Primarily through trusted domestic trading companies and wholesalers. This ensures flexible payment terms, smooth customs and quarantine procedures, and a stable logistics network. Direct transactions are also possible depending on conditions.

Q2. Can you handle small lots?

Yes. With trading company support, we can handle small-lot shipments for trial imports or market testing, as well as large-scale regular shipments. Even small lots follow export standards, ensuring quality verification before full-scale transactions.

Q3. From which ports do you ship?

We mainly use Japan’s key ports, providing efficient access to Asia, North America, and Europe. Routes and ports are chosen with trading companies and logistics partners according to deadlines and costs.

Q4. What are the payment methods?

For trading company transactions, terms follow each company’s conditions (T/T, L/C, etc.). For direct trade, international standard methods such as T/T bank transfers or L/C are available. We ensure reliable payment methods for safe transactions, even for those new to international trade.

Company Overview

Company Name: Joint Farm Co., Ltd.
Representative: Tomokazu Shindo, President & CEO
Established: December 2, 2016
Head Office: 3-60-1 Yachigashira, Misawa City, Aomori Prefecture, 033-0164
TEL: +81-176-58-6511 / FAX: +81-176-58-6512
Branch Office: 1-2-1 Kanaya, Rokunohe Town, Kamikita District, Aomori Prefecture, 033-0073
TEL: +81-176-27-5370 / FAX: +81-176-27-5371
Capital: JPY 24,867,000
Employees: 42 (as of April 2024)
Products & Volumes: Nagaimo (Japanese yam) (approx. 1,500 tons), Burdock (approx. 600 tons), Garlic (approx. 80 tons) – FY2024 results
Main Clients: Produce wholesalers, processors, restaurant franchises, online retailers, supermarket chains, trading companies (domestic Japan, U.S., Southeast Asia)
